593,303 miembros*
5,526 online*
Registrase aquí GRATIS
Login
593,303 miembros
IndustryArena Foro > Informática > Hardware > problemas para configurar cnc
Resultados 1 al 2 de 2

Vista Híbrida

  1. #1
    Junior Member
    Fecha de Ingreso
    18 Jul, 17
    Ubicación
    Zacatecas
    Mensajes
    1

    Post problemas para configurar cnc

    Buenas soy nuevo en esto tengo un problemas tengo mi cnc la compre como hace diez años pero apenas le eche andar pero en días pasados me paro uno de los ejes y empezó a vibrar cambie los ejes en los conectores y el motor funciono bien y el otro eje que funcionaba bien empezó a vibrar lo pague los volví a conectar como es y volvió a vibrar e eje me metí a en el mach 3 para configurar en moto tunig lo acelere y se quito la vibración pero el checar la configuración me marca más distancia lo ajuste peor me volvió a meter la vibración por que le quita velocidad he buscado información pero no encuentro alguna solución no se si alguien aquí haya experimentado algo parecido que me pueda ayudar a configurar o corregir ese problema
    Datos del motor de paso
    Motores a pasos: 1. Step angle: 1.8 degree 2. Number of Phase: 2 3. Hold torque: 4.4 kg.cm 4. Rated current/Phase: 1.68 amps. 5. Phase resistance: 1.65 ohms 6. Voltage/Phase: 2.77 VDC

  2. #2
    Member
    Fecha de Ingreso
    24 May, 07
    Ubicación
    Argentina
    Mensajes
    194
    Normalmente el eje X e Y van configurados iguales, el que puede diferir es el Z, en el Mach tenés una función para calibrar la distancia, sino te paso la macro que hice para un Botón

    Sub Main()
    Begin Dialog GroupSample 31,32,120,96,"Selección Eje"
    OKButton 38,75,40,14
    GroupBox 12,8,96,62,"Sel. Eje a Calibrar",.GroupBox1
    OptionGroup .OptionGroup1
    OptionButton 20,24,40,8,"Eje X",.OptionButton1
    OptionButton 20,40,40,8,"Eje Y",.OptionButton2
    OptionButton 20,56,40,8,"Eje Z",.OptionButton3
    OptionButton 67,24,40,8,"Eje A",.OptionButton4
    OptionButton 67,40,40,8,"Eje B",.OptionButton5
    OptionButton 67,56,40,8,"Eje C",.OptionButton6
    End Dialog

    Dim Dlg1 As GroupSample
    Button = Dialog (Dlg1)
    If Button = 0 Then
    Exit Sub
    End If
    AxisNum = Dlg1.OptionGroup1

    Select Case AxisNum
    Case 0 'HSS
    Axis = "StepsPerAxisX"
    Axis_Letter = "X"
    Case 1 'HSStin
    Axis = "StepsPerAxisY"
    Axis_Letter =" Y"
    Case 2 'Carbide
    Axis = "StepsPerAxisZ"
    Axis_Letter = "Z"
    Case 3 'Carbide
    Axis = "StepsPerAxisA"
    Axis_Letter = "A"
    Case 4 'Carbide
    Axis = "StepsPerAxisB"
    Axis_Letter = "B"
    Case 5 'Carbide
    Axis = "StepsPerAxisC"
    Axis_Letter = "C"
    End Select

    Com_Move = Question ("Cuánto desea mover el Eje " & Axis_Letter & " ?")

    If COM_Move = 0 Then
    MsgBox "No puedo Mover de Zero, Cálculo Eje abortado."
    Exit Sub
    End If
    Code "G0 G91 " & Axis_Letter & Com_Move
    While Ismoving()
    Wend
    Code "G4 P0.5"
    Act_Move = Question("Cuánto movió el Eje " & Axis_Letter & " ? (Valor Medido)")
    If Act_Move = 0 Then
    MsgBox "No puedo Mover de Zero, Cálculo Eje abortado."
    Exit Sub
    End If


    Old_PPR = GetParam(Axis)

    New_PPR = Abs((Com_Move/Act_Move) * Old_PPR)
    Response = MsgBox ( "Eje " & Axis_Letter & " fue Seteado a " & New_PPR & " Steps x Uni. Acepta el valor ?", 4 , "Set Steps x Uni.")
    If Response = 6 Then ' User chose Yes.
    Call SetParam(Axis, New_PPR)
    MsgBox ("Eje " & Axis_Letter & " fue Seteado")
    Else ' User chose No.
    MsgBox ("Eje " & Axis_Letter & " NO fue Seteado")
    End If

    End Sub
    Main
    Esta Macro te permitirá ajustar la distancia pedida, de la medida y se ajustará automaticamente en el "Motor Tunning"

    Contame que drivers tenés o subi una foto, como lo tenes seteados, cuantos micropasos, todo esto puede hacer que vibren.

    Saludos Fernando
    Valvulin@gmail.com

Permisos de Publicación

  • No puedes crear nuevos temas
  • No puedes responder temas
  • No puedes subir archivos adjuntos
  • No puedes editar tus mensajes
  •